在C#中使用SharpSSH无法更改sftp远程目录?

时间:2012-08-16 12:11:19

标签: c# sharpssh

我已经尝试了我能想到的路径字符串的每个组合,但我仍然回来"The requested file does not exist"?我在过去的几个小时里搜索了互联网,我找不到一个例子。任何人都可以指出我做错了什么。我已经尝试了以下内容。

使用root中的ls命令。我得到了可用的目录和文件列表。所以说它返回了以下列表。

Outbound Inbound

我到目前为止已经尝试过了。

cd ./Inbound/
cd /Inbound/
cd Inbound
cd //Inbound//
cd //Inbound
cd Inbound/
cd ../Inbound/
cd \Inbound\
cd \\Inbound\\
cd ..\\Inbound\\

1 个答案:

答案 0 :(得分:1)

我曾经在SharpSSH库(bitbucket.org/mattgwagner/SharpSSH)上做过一些维护工作,但老实说我建议您查看sshnet.codeplex.com以获得设计合理且功能更强的库。我认为,最初的SharpSSH是.NET 1.1的Java库的DIRECT端口,并且受到翻译的影响。